Diwali Pet Treat Recipes
Dr. Deepak Saraswat, Head Vet, Zigly, shared with HT Digital some delicious recipes for our fur babies to celebrate the joy of Diwali together.
1. Peanut Butter and Banana Pupcakes
These mini cakes are a hit with dogs and are a healthier alternative to traditional treats.
Ingredients:
1 sliced banana, mashed
3 tablespoons peanut butter (unsalted and unsweetened)
1/2 cup whole wheat flour
1/2 teaspoon of baking soda
1/2 teaspoon of baking powder
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 175°C
2. In a mixing bowl, combine the mashed banana and peanut butter
3. In a separate bowl, mix together the whole wheat flour, baking soda and baking powder.
4. Slowly add the dry mixture to the banana and peanut butter mixture, stirring until well combined.
5. Scoop the batter into mini muffin tins
6. Bake for about 10-15 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ean
7. Leave the cupcakes to cool before serving
2. Carrot and oat cookies
Carrots are not only healthy, but also add a delicious crunch to these treats
Ingredients:
1 cup rolled oats
1/2 cup grated carrots
1/4 cup unsweetened applesauce
1/4 cup of water
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 175°C
2. In a food processor, pulse the rolled oats until they reach a thick consistency of flour
3. Combine the oatmeal, grated carrot, sugar-free applesauce, and water in a bowl.
4. Knead the mixture into a paste, adding more water if necessary
5. Roll out the dough and use cookie cutters to create fun shapes
6. Place the cookies on a baking sheet and bake for 20-25 minutes or until they are slightly crispy.
7. Allow to cool completely before serving
3. Cheesy Catnip Crunchies
Don’t forget our feline friends. Cats love sweets too, and these crunchy treats are a perfect choice.
Ingredients:
1/2 cup whole wheat flour
1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
1 tablespoon of grated parmesan cheese
1 spoon of plain yogurt
1 teaspoon of catnip
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 175°C
2. In a food processor, combine the whole wheat flour, cheddar cheese and Parmesan cheese.
3. Pulse the mixture until it reaches a crumbly texture
4. Add plain yogurt and catnip, and continue pulsing until the dough forms
5. Roll the dough into small balls and flatten with a fork
6. Place the sweets on a pan and bake for about 10-12 minutes until they become golden brown.
7. Leave the crunchies to cool before offering them to your feline friend
4. Sweet potato chews
Sweet potatoes are a fantastic source of vitamins and make an excellent treat for your pets.
Ingredients:
2 sweet potatoes, washed and peeled
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 120°C
2. Cut the sweet potatoes into thin strips, too
3. Place the sweet potato strips on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per
4. Bake for about 2 hours or until the strips are dry and chewy
5. Allow to cool before serving
